Интерфейс IWICBitmapFrameEncode (wincodec.h)

Представляет отдельные кадры изображений кодировщика.

Наследование

Интерфейс IWICBitmapFrameEncode наследуется от интерфейса IUnknown . IWICBitmapFrameEncode также содержит следующие типы элементов:

Методы

Интерфейс IWICBitmapFrameEncode содержит следующие методы.

 
IWICBitmapFrameEncode::Commit

Фиксирует кадр в изображении.
IWICBitmapFrameEncode::GetMetadataQueryWriter

Возвращает модуль записи запросов метаданных для кадра кодировщика.
IWICBitmapFrameEncode::Initialize

Инициализирует кодировщик кадра с помощью заданных свойств.
IWICBitmapFrameEncode::SetColorContexts

Задает заданное число профилей IWICColorContext для кадра.
IWICBitmapFrameEncode::SetPalette

Задает IWICPalette для индексированных форматов пикселей.
IWICBitmapFrameEncode::SetPixelFormat

Запрашивает, чтобы кодировщик использовал указанный формат пикселей.
IWICBitmapFrameEncode::SetResolution

Задает физическое разрешение выходного изображения.
IWICBitmapFrameEncode::SetSize

Задает размеры выходного изображения для кадра.
IWICBitmapFrameEncode::SetThumbnail

Задает эскиз кадра, если он поддерживается кодеком.
IWICBitmapFrameEncode::WritePixels

Копирует данные строки сканирования из буфера, предоставленного вызывающим объектом, в объект IWICBitmapFrameEncode.
IWICBitmapFrameEncode::WriteSource

Кодирует источник растрового изображения.

Требования

Требование Значение
Минимальная версия клиента Windows XP с пакетом обновления 2 (SP2), Windows Vista [классические приложения | Приложения UWP]
Минимальная версия сервера Windows Server 2008 [классические приложения | Приложения UWP]
Целевая платформа Windows
Header wincodec.h

См. также раздел

Пример кодека AITCodec

Основные понятия

Создание кодека WIC-Enabled

Другие ресурсы

ИДЕНТИФИКАТОРы GUID WIC и CLSID

Общие сведения о компоненте обработки образов Windows